2 A Few Moments with Thomas Dear Brothers and Sisters in Christ, Well, it's here again. The Christmas season is upon us and we are gearing up to the mad rush of Christmas shopping, so I will keep this letter short. Because our time is so precious and short. Christmas day is coming fast. I'm sure many of us have family events, work parties, children's concerts and performances all coming up too. Not to mention decorating, Christmas baking, and getting all those Christmas Cards out. In the past we have heard it said that we should try and let go of these responsibilities. We have read in the book of Luke not to get caught up in all of it, the "worries of this life." Instead, we are to enjoy the reason for the season. But don't you find that these activities - the letters, cookies, shopping, concerts, parties, decorating and such- are a part of how we get ourselves ready and excited for the holiday, this Holy Day? This, along with our special Sunday sermons, the lighting of a different Advent candle each week in preparation for the glorious day is how we mark Christmas as the special occasion it is and should be. Remember though, Advent isn't just about Christmas preparation, it means "coming," and that is what this season is about. In our Christmas preparation time we are here not only to celebrate what God has done in the past through the birth of baby Jesus, we are also here to call for preparation for Jesus' coming again. Please join us on Sunday mornings this Christmas season as we practice Advent as a season of preparation. Luke 2:8-14 God bless and Merry Christmas. Epiphany, January 6th, celebrates the arrival of the three kings who traveled from far away to worship the newborn Jesus. In 2016 the church observes Epiphany on the prior Sunday, January 3rd followed by the Baptism of our Lord observance on January 10th. Epiphany continues through January and into February until Ash Wednesday on February 10th. 3

8 Recipe for a New Year. Take twelve fine, full-grown months; see that these are thoroughly free from old memories of bitterness, rancor and hate, cleanse them completely from every clinging spite; pick off all specks of pettiness and littleness; in short, see that these months are freed from all the past have them fresh and clean as when they first came from the great storehouse of Time. Cut these months into thirty or thirty-one equal parts. Do not attempt to make up the whole batch at one time (so many persons spoil the entire lot this way) but prepare one day at a time. Into each day put equal parts of faith, patience, courage, work (some people omit this ingredient and so spoil the flavor of the rest), hope, fidelity, liberality, kindness, rest (leaving this out is like leaving the oil out of the salad dressing don t do it), prayer, meditation, and one well-selected resolution. Put in about one teaspoonful of good spirits, a dash of fun, a pinch of folly, a sprinkling of play, and a heaping cupful of good humor. Anonymous Glen Reformed Church P.O.
